I started on walls.
SAMO© was the spark — cryptic messages sprayed on SoHo streets.
Then the canvas became my battlefield. My voice. My roar.

I painted like I couldn’t hold it in.
Royalty, jazz, history, Black identity, capitalism, chaos.
Symbols and crowns. Anatomy and anger. Language and noise.
Everything meant something. Especially what looked like it didn’t.

I burned fast, but I made noise that still echoes.
